~ ^ C <br />• Debris, Acid-forming or Toxic-forming Wastes and Flammable Materials <br />Geochemical tests of the coal, development waste, and process waste <br />materials show no significant release of acid-forming or toxic-forming <br />substances from these materials (refer to Geochemical Report, Appendix <br />4-D.) To further protect against any potential contamination to the <br />environment, the following safeguards are employed. <br />° Drainage from the disturbed area is routed for treatment <br />in sediment control structures, and clean water runoff is <br />diverted from contact with the disturbed area .as outlined <br />in Protection of the Hydrologic Balance, Section 4.6.1.3. <br />° Coal waste ponds confine waste material to prevent contact <br />with surface and ground waters. The ponds are maintained <br />and operated as detailed in Protection of the Hydrologic <br />Balance. <br />• All boreholes, shafts, and wells are sealed to prevent <br />pollution of surface or ground water and to prevent mixing <br />of ground waters of significantly different quality. <br /> <br />4-25 <br />
